Summary

Indian banking system deposits have reached a record high after recent significant growth. This surge is primarily supported by dollar inflows into banks from a central bank scheme. The Reserve Bank of India's foreign-currency non-resident scheme attracted substantial foreign currency deposits. These inflows have helped boost overall banking system deposits to a new record level. Credit conditions are expected to remain strong as deposit growth continues.
